在Linux操作系统上,MySQL数据库的数据目录通常默认设置为/var/lib/mysql。这个目录是MySQL用来存储数据库表数据、日志文件和其他数据库相关文件的地方。在部署和管理MySQL数据库时,对data目录的管理至关重要。
首先,备份是对data目录管理的一个重要方面。由于data目录中存储着数据库的重要数据,一旦数据丢失或损坏,可能会给企业带来严重的损失。因此,定期对data目录进行备份是至关重要的。红帽提供了各种备份工具和技术,如使用rsync、tar等工具,或者利用LVM快照技术来备份data目录,确保数据的安全性和可恢复性。
其次,对data目录的权限管理也是至关重要的。只有合适的权限设置,才能确保数据库的安全性和稳定性。在Linux系统中,可以使用chmod和chown命令来修改data目录的权限,限制只有数据库管理员和授权用户才能够访问和修改data目录中的文件。红帽还提供了用户和权限管理工具,如SELinux和ACL,来增强对data目录的访问控制。
此外,对于data目录的容量管理也是必不可少的。随着数据库数据的增长,data目录可能会出现空间不足的情况。因此,及时监控data目录的存储空间使用情况,并根据需要进行扩容或优化是非常重要的。红帽提供了诸多存储管理解决方案,如LVM、Btrfs等,来帮助企业有效地管理data目录的容量。
总的来说,对于Linux操作系统上MySQL数据库的data目录管理,需要综合考虑备份、权限管理和容量管理等多个方面。红帽企业提供了丰富的技术和工具,帮助企业更好地管理和保护data目录中的数据库数据。通过合理的管理和优化,可以确保数据库系统的稳定性、安全性和可靠性,从而更好地支持企业的业务运营和发展。